网站构建核心指南:框架选型与设计模式精解
|
在网站构建过程中,选择合适的框架是决定项目成败的关键一步。主流框架如React、Vue和Angular各具优势。React以组件化为核心,适合构建动态交互强的单页应用;Vue则以轻量与渐进式著称,上手快且文档友好;Angular提供完整的解决方案,适合大型企业级项目。选型时需结合团队技术栈、项目规模及长期维护需求综合判断。 设计模式是提升代码可维护性与扩展性的核心手段。面向对象中的工厂模式可用于统一创建复杂对象,避免硬编码。观察者模式在状态管理中表现突出,尤其适用于数据流驱动的界面更新。模块化设计通过将功能拆分为独立单元,降低耦合度,便于协作开发与测试。 组件化思想贯穿现代前端开发。无论是使用React的JSX还是Vue的模板语法,都强调“高内聚、低耦合”的设计原则。合理划分组件边界,使每个组件专注单一职责,能显著提升复用率与调试效率。例如,将导航栏、用户卡片等通用元素抽象为可复用组件,避免重复编写。
2026AI模拟图,仅供参考 状态管理是复杂应用的难点。对于中小型项目,局部状态(如useState)已足够;而当数据流复杂、跨组件通信频繁时,引入Redux、Pinia或Vuex等状态管理库可有效解耦视图与数据逻辑。关键在于保持状态集中可控,避免“状态爆炸”。性能优化不容忽视。通过懒加载路由、代码分割、静态资源压缩等手段,可显著提升首屏加载速度。合理使用虚拟列表处理大数据渲染,避免页面卡顿。同时,响应式设计确保在不同设备上呈现一致体验。 最终,优秀的网站构建不仅是技术堆叠,更是对架构思维的考验。清晰的分层结构、合理的依赖关系、规范的命名与注释,共同构成可持续演进的代码基础。持续学习与实践,方能在快速迭代的前端生态中立于不败之地。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

